Clarence B. Read, 83 years, longtime resident of Lake Geneva and currently of Elkhorn, passed to eternal life on Saturday, November 18, 2023 at his residence.
Clarence was born on December 9, 1939 in Elkhorn to Clarence G. and Madalyn (Barrett) Read. Clarence married Elizabeth J. Welch on June 23, 1959 in Elkhorn. She preceded him in death on February 14, 2017 and he married Susan Cooler on May 22, 2019 in Lake Geneva.
Clarence was a Longtime member of St. Francis de Sales Church in Lake Geneva, Knights of Columbus Council 1647, Knights of Columbus 4th Degree Assembly 1685 in Burlington, and an IBEW Union Member. Clarence was a longtime area electrician. He is survived by his wife Susan, children Loraine “Lori” (Craig) Seabrooks of Prescott, AZ, Clarence M.
